The defect
Spartan Motors, Inc. (Spartan) is recalling certain model year 2013-2015 Gladiator, DR, K2, K3, MetroStar, MM, and NVS vehicles manufactured December 14, 2011, to October 21, 2014, equipped with certain Wabco Quick Release Valves with Double Check. In the affected valves, the rubber diaphragm may be damaged by sharp edges on the valve seat ribs, reducing the available air pressure in the air tanks.
The risk
The reduced air pressure levels may reduce braking performance and/or the parking brakes could reapply, increasing the risk of a crash.

Check VIN on NHTSA →The fix — what to do
Spartan will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and replace the valve, free of charge. The recall began January 22, 2015. Owners may contact Spartan customer service at 1-517-543-6400. Spartan's number for this recall is 14021.
